đź“° Most-clicked stories this week
Ordinances expand mobility guidelines: Fort Wayne introduced new e-bike rules, defining what is allowed on trails and sidewalks and setting fines. Riders must yield to slower users and give an audible signal before passing — see what’s in the ordinances.
A hands-on art adventure: The Glass Park on Fairfield Avenue offers glass art classes where you design your own piece. Owner Eran Park welcomes families and beginners to explore glass and create something memorable — see how to participate.
